JULIET’S STORY:

Juliet was born a street dog in Malaysia where she lived a perilous life, surviving from day to day, in Ipoh City, Perak, north of Kuala Lumpur. When she was just a few months old, she wandered into the wet market, a massive fresh food marketplace catering to mostly foreigners, with both indoor and covered quarters. There, a dog-hating vendor threw a caustic acid substance at her, causing horrific chemical burns on a significant section of her hindquarters, tail, and underbelly.

Many dogs in Juliet’s condition would simply be left to suffer in extreme agony until death, as there are far too many street dogs at large in Malaysia – countless of them, injured or disabled – and far too few capable people able to handle these complicated medical cases. Lucky for Juliet, she was taken under the loving wing of Malaysian Dogs Deserve Better (MDDB), an extraordinary animal welfare group based out of the capital city of Kuala Lumpur.

Juliet underwent many painful months of burn treatment. Her tender and tortured skin had to be scrubbed daily to remove dead cells and encourage regrowth of new skin. Despite the agony this caused, she endured everything like a champion.

Today, she is a healthy and happy puppy, described as gorgeous, confident, mischievous, and playful as a lark by MDDB’s founder. How incredible to imagine, given all she has been put through at the hands of man!

MDDB firmly wants the very best for this sweetheart of a survivor – and it is difficult to find dedicated adopters in her home nation, especially for street dogs, often considered common, and even more so when they are thought to be “damaged goods”. Her best bet at finding a forever home, one where she will never be put in danger of having anything like this happen to her again, is overseas adoption.
